Reunion over, family heading home, it was now time to get some dental repair done (replacing a sensitive cracked filling) and then turn my attention to "Cheaper than Therapy", my monthly hostess club.  The next meeting was Friday July 12.  This month's theme was Punch Power, using punches to create 3 distinct card fronts.  Here are the cards I prepared for the ladies to do:







Decorative Label, Scallop Oval, Postage Stamp and 1" Square punches were used to create this card in Early Espresso and Pistachio Pudding card stock, using the Postage Due stamp set.





Next, 3/4", 1", 1-1/4" and Cupcake Builder punches were used to fashion this fun monochromatic flower arrangement.  Isn't that a cute greeting?  Love the fonts found in the "Four You" stamp set.







 Then on to this quick-and-easy card perfect for all sorts of occasions.  Adding a bit of Designer Series Paper (here Polka Dot Parade) to line the envelope takes a simple card to simply charming.

The details are a bit hard to see in my picture, but that blue rectangle is actually a mini-"envelope" created using our Hexagon punch  and finished off with on of our new Candy Dots.
The card was finished using a stamp from "Sassy Salutations".
